The Laredo Lemurs Saga Unfolds
The Laredo (TX) City Council voted this week to send a letter to all parties involved with the Laredo Lemurs (Independent Professional, American Association) to vacate the premises of Uni-Trade Stadium and pursue proposals for buyers or leasers for the stadium. Read more here.

Lemurs Announce Two-Game Sister Cities Classic
The indy pro Laredo Lemurs (American Association) and Tecolotes de Nuevo Laredo (Liga del Norte) will battle it out in the two-game Sister Cities Baseball Classic. The first game will be played at Uni-Trade Stadium on November 6, 2014 at 7:30 p.m. The teams will then travel just across the border for a game at Parque La Junta Field on November 7, 2014 at 7:30 p.m. Read more here. Laredo Council Approves Deal with Lemurs’ New Ownership
The Laredo (TX) City Council on Tuesday approved a memorandum of understanding with the new owners of the indy pro Laredo Lemurs (American Association) for operating the team at Uni-Trade Stadium. The league must still approve the ownership transfer. The ownership group, Laredo Baseball Holdings, is reportedly from Mexico. Read more and watch news report here. Inaugural Lemurs Open New Park
The indy pro Laredo Lemurs opened the new Uni-Trade Stadium in front of a reported crowd of 5,923, as the home team defeated the Grand Prairie AirHog 5-1. Read more and view news clip here. View photos here.

It’s ‘Uni-Trade Stadium’ for the Lemurs
Uni-Trade Forwarding, LLC has purchased the naming rights for the new $18 million ballpark being built for the indy pro Laredo Lemurs (American Association). The ballpark will be known as “Uni-Trade Stadium.” Read more here.
